The Cuscinetto model dates back to 1983 when Tonino Lamborghini created one of his first timepieces taking inspiration from a specific mechanical element, the ball bearing (in Italian, cuscinetto). He created this model using a special bidirectional rotating bezel with a design that recalls the mechanical element used to reduce the friction between two moving parts. The timepiece has two interchangeable straps: a leather strap with coloured stitching and coloured rubber inserts, and a monochrome rubber band. This customized stainless steel deployante buckle, with a branded titanium coating and shield in relief, is made by Armand Nicolet.
